
Three Lens View
In our journey through life, we each develop unique ways of perceiving and understanding the world. This journey is framed by three distinct yet interconnected lenses: the creative, the meaningful, and the spiritual. These perspectives shape my worldview and guide me toward forging relationships with those who embody a natural balance of these elements.
The Creative Lens
Creativity is the heartbeat of human expression. I imagine the world through a creative lens that sees ideas with imagination. This perspective allows me to appreciate the unique ways individuals express themselves through art, music, literature, or innovative problem-solving. Creativity is more than just artistic endeavors; it is a way of thinking and engaging with the world that fosters innovation and beauty in everyday life.
When I meet someone who embodies creativity, I am drawn to their ability to think outside the box and to see possibilities where others see obstacles. Their presence adds vibrancy to my life, inspiring me to explore new ideas and perspectives. This shared appreciation for creativity becomes a foundation for building meaningful relationships.

The Meaningful Lens
Meaningfulness, on the other hand, is about depth and purpose. I seek the substance and significance of experiences and interactions through this lens. The quest for understanding the “why” behind actions and the connections gives our lives depth and direction.
A person who lives a meaningful life often exudes a sense of purpose and clarity. They are not merely drifting through life; they navigate it with intention and thoughtfulness. In relationships, this translates to a depth of connection that goes beyond the superficial. Conversations are rich, and shared experiences are imbued with purpose. Both parties feel valued and understood in meaningful relationships, creating a bond.

The Spiritual Lens
The spiritual lens offers a view of life that transcends the material and the tangible. It is about recognizing and connecting with the unseen, the divine, or the essence of what makes us human. In this sense, spirituality is not confined to religious practices but is a broader sense of connectedness to something greater than ourselves.
Meeting someone with a spiritual dimension to their life brings a sense of peace and grounding. Their presence often radiates a calm and deep understanding of life’s mysteries. They provide a perspective that can comfort and uplift, offering a sense of shared humanity and universal connection. Spiritual relationships nurture the soul and provide a sanctuary of mutual respect and support.

Balance and Harmony
When encountering individuals who naturally balance creativity, meaningfulness, and spirituality, I sense a rare and beautiful harmony. These are the people who inspire me, challenge me, and [comfort] me. They bring a holistic richness to relationships, blending the imaginative, the purposeful, and the profound.
I find the greatest fulfillment in these balanced relationships. The creative lens brings excitement and innovation, the meaningful lens provides depth and purpose, and the spiritual lens offers peace and connection. Together, these perspectives create a foundation for relationships that are not only lasting but profoundly enriching.
By viewing life through these three lenses, I have learned to appreciate the multifaceted nature of human existence. It has taught me to seek out and cherish those who bring balance and harmony to my life, leading to significant, meaningful relationships—sometimes for a lifetime and sometimes for a season.
